The Peninsula Commissioning and Procurement Partnership is a longstanding collaboration between Devon County Council, Plymouth City Council, Torbay Council and Somerset County Council.
The proposed Framework Agreement is likely to include the provision of Standard Fostering placements for children in care, Enhanced Foster placements, Staying Put placements for young adults, Parent and Child Placements and Assessments and short breaks placements.
The Framework Agreement will increase the supply of high quality, locally available placements in a family setting.
In order to achieve positive outcomes for vulnerable children and young people, there is a focus on supporting placement stability and permanence for children and young people.
The Framework Agreements will also aim to achieve improved value for money for placing authorities through greater transparency of pricing and competition through call-off.
